Star admits first series of Downton Abbey better than second
Image © REUTERS/Luke MacGregor
The actress, who plays Cora, Countess of Grantham in the Julian Fellowes' ITV1 period drama, said that the first series was more to her taste.
'There is a slightly different tone to the second season, partly because the show had to deal with this huge elephant which is the First World War, and in some ways Downton Abbey wasn't set up for that,' she told The LA Times.
'What's made the show successful and different is that attention to character detail and that's what the audience likes.
Writers [in the second season] had to do a lot of glossing over the domestic life. Some of the small moments between characters that characterised the first season.'
